- #if !defined(BOOST_FUSION_SEGMENTED_BEGIN_HPP_INCLUDED)
- #define BOOST_FUSION_SEGMENTED_BEGIN_HPP_INCLUDED
- #include <boost/fusion/support/config.hpp>
- #include <boost/fusion/sequence/intrinsic/detail/segmented_begin_impl.hpp>
- #include <boost/fusion/iterator/segmented_iterator.hpp>
- #include <boost/fusion/view/iterator_range.hpp>
- #include <boost/fusion/sequence/intrinsic/begin.hpp>
- #include <boost/fusion/sequence/intrinsic/end.hpp>
- #include <boost/fusion/sequence/intrinsic/empty.hpp>
- #include <boost/fusion/container/list/cons.hpp>
- namespace boost { namespace fusion { namespace detail
- {
- //auto segmented_begin( seq )
- //{
- // return make_segmented_iterator( segmented_begin_impl( seq, nil_ ) );
- //}
- template <typename Sequence, typename Nil_ = fusion::nil_>
- struct segmented_begin
- {
- typedef
- segmented_iterator<
- typename segmented_begin_impl<Sequence, Nil_>::type
- >
- type;
- BOOST_CONSTEXPR BOOST_FUSION_GPU_ENABLED
- static type call(Sequence& seq)
- {
- return type(
- segmented_begin_impl<Sequence, Nil_>::call(seq, Nil_()));
- }
- };
- }}}
- #endif
